**Responsibilities**:
- Perform basic and moderately complex level one troubleshooting and repair activities, typically associated with an end-user environment, including but not limited to desktops, laptops, mobile devices, desk phones, and printers.- Fulfil service requests such as granting network drive access, administration of distribution lists, creation/modification/disabling accounts, fulfilling software requests, etc.- Install, and troubleshoot end user printers.- Meet established customer service satisfaction levels and other operational/customer service metrics as outlined in established guidelines.- Understand and follow all documented service operations policies and procedures.- Document processes, procedures, and Knowledge Base articles.- Work in a large team environment, supporting and assisting peers.- Direct unresolved issues to the next level of support personnel.- Identify and suggest possible improvements to procedures.- Participate in the evaluation/implementation of ITIL best-practice operational processes.- Maintain an inventory of installed hardware and software.- Primary work hours will fall between 6:00 AM CT and 6:00 PM CT. There is a possibility of rotating after hour on-call support.

What We Are Looking For- 2+ years' experience working in Information Technology, preferably on a Service Desk/Helpdesk- Self-starter, able to work with mínimal supervision after the initial induction- Experience working in a diverse, multi-branch environment- Strong problem-solving and decision-making skills that promote collaboration, consensus, and innovation- Outstanding interpersonal skills with the ability to work effectively with diverse groups of people- Proven commitment to customer service and ITIL best-practice operational processes- Service Management focused on exceptional customer service and organization skills- IT designation preferred (CIPS, ITIL A+, CompTIA, MCSA, etc.)- Degree or Diploma from a computer technology program an asset- Ability to forge, grow and maintain positive relationships with multiple groups- Detail-oriented, self-motivated, and resourceful, with strong time management skills- Ability to remain objective and maintain a factual perspective when dealing with questions and inquiries- Sense of urgency and 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ously and meet the time demands of unpredictable activities- Capable of handling pressure and challenges in a dynamic business environment- Strong analytical, critical thinking, troubleshooting, problem-solving skills, and a high degree of accuracy and attention to detail- Highly developed interpersonal, communication, and organizational skills- Ability to work collaboratively with a positive attitude
